The WF-3820 is the small-office speed pick. Faster printing + 250-sheet tray + 35-page ADF makes it the right buy for home offices with regular multi-page printing. Trade-off vs Brother is ink cost per page.
Strengths
- +PrecisionCore technology for sharper text than the Brother MFC-J1360DW
- +Faster print speed (21 ppm black)
- +250-sheet paper tray + 35-page ADF
- +Auto-duplex + 2.7" color touchscreen
Watch-outs
- −Epson cartridges are more expensive per page than Brother INKvestment
- −Larger footprint than HP Envy 6555e
- −Some buyers prefer Epson EcoTank tanks (higher initial cost)
How it compares
Fastest pick. Largest paper tray. Higher ink cost than Brother. Better for high-volume than HP Envy.
